Abstract

A weft insertion apparatus for a series shed weaving machine contains a unit of fixed location with a plurality of passages (,) and with a plurality of nozzles (,) and a unit which rotates with the weaving rotor (,) with a plurality of nozzles (,) to draw off the weft threads which are supplied to the passages and to shoot them successively into the shed. This apparatus enables the insertion of weft threads of different kinds in rapid succession.
